Q: Is 14,625,036 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 14,625,036 is not a prime number.

Why is 14,625,036 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 14625036 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 9 12 18 27 36 54 81 108 162 324 45,139 90,278 135,417 180,556 270,834 406,251 541,668 812,502 1,218,753 1,625,004 2,437,506 3,656,259 4,875,012 7,312,518 and 14,625,036, with no remainder.

Since 14,625,036 cannot be divided by just 1 and 14,625,036, it is not a prime number.
